A motorcycle is traveling up one side of the hill and down the other side. The crest of the hill is a circular park with the radius of 45.0 m.
(a) determines the maximum speed that the cycle can have while moving over the crest without losing contact with the road.
(b) if the motorcycle travels over the crest at half the speed found in part (a), find the ratio between the apparent weight of the motorcycle and its rider and their true weight.
